Machinery of H.M.S. Thames; length 345 ft, breadth 28 ft, surface displacement 2165 tons; each of Vickers-Armstrongs twin engines has 10 cyl of 21-in. diam and 21-in. stroke, and works on 4-stroke single-acting cycle; at official sea trials 10,000 shp at 405 rpm was developed by two engines at 22 1/2 knots.
